Statistical Reporting
Companies that write fidelity and/or surety business may
report statistics to the SFAA
on an annual basis. Reporting companies must
use the codes specified in the
SFAA
Fidelity and Surety Statistical Plan to submit data to SFAA. Upon
receipt of
company data, a series of edits are performed to check for accuracy
and validity. These
edits are defined in the SFAA
Actuarial Edit Definitions. At the end of each calendar year,
the SFAA
posts to this site the Call
for Statistics which provides the guidelines, the mailing
address, and the
due date for submitting data.
